DIRTY AIRLINE SECRETS

Some ā€œtipsā€ for flying commercial airlines are pretty much intuitive. For example,Ā  the floor of the plane is absolutely filthy. Donā€™t go barefoot and for gawdā€™s sake if you drop your mint, donā€™t pick it up and pop it back in your mouth. Also, the blankets and pillows on flights are rarely washed and cleaned.Ā 

But I learned some stuff I didnā€™t know in a piece on the secrets of flight attendants. For example:

ā€“ Donā€™t drink airplane coffee. The water comes from the onboard system and the fill port is right next to the port from which the lavatories are drained. E coli contamination is a common thing. (Well, ick!)

ā€“ When the cabin crew stands at the entrance to greet you, theyā€™re not trying to be nice. They are judging you as to whether they might have a problem passenger. So, be good.

ā€“ Flight attendants can be personally fined if they fail to tell you to fasten your seat belt when the seat belt light is on.Ā 

ONE LAST POLL LOOK

Itā€™s instructive to look at the last University of Nevada poll, which got the governorā€™s race and the U.S. Senate race bassackwards.

The poll predicted Gov. Steve Sisolak and Sen. Catherine Cortez Masto would win re-election, with the governorā€™s race close but the Senate race a runaway.Ā 

Turned out thatĀ  Republican Joe Lombardo ran away with the governorā€™s race, and Cortez Masto narrowly squeaked out a victory.Ā
